The weep of star
The star was shining,
the star was blinking,
the star was weeping,
Can you even see it?
Across the universe,
hiding behind the sun,
stay beside the moon,
but there was so few.
The star was hanging,
the star was staying,
the star still weeps,
do even know it?
There was a lot,
friends was what they called,
forgotten since you grown,
There they still weep their thoughts.
The star was sorrow,
the star was memory,
the star was weeping,
Would they ever stopped?
